.rui-sign{display:flex;flex-direction:column;min-height:100vh}.rui-sign .rui-sign-form{max-width:380px;padding:30px}.rui-sign .rui-sign-form-cloud{max-width:400px;padding:40px;background-color:#fff;border-radius:.25rem;box-shadow:0 3px 10px rgba(0,0,0,.03)}.rui-sign .rui-sign-or{display:flex;align-items:center;color:#bcbec0}.rui-sign .rui-sign-or:after,.rui-sign .rui-sign-or:before{content:"";display:block;width:100%;height:1px;margin-bottom:-3px;border-bottom:1px solid #e6ecf0}.rui-sign .rui-sign-or:before{margin-right:20px}.rui-sign .rui-sign-or:after{margin-left:20px}.rui-sign-form .svg-inline--fa.rui-icon{width:1em;min-width:1em;height:1em}.rui-router-transition-exit-active>.rui-sign{min-height:calc(100vh - 20px);padding-top:20px}.pay-icons-failed{display:flex;flex-direction:column;align-items:center;justify-content:center}.pay-icons-failed>.rui-icon{width:60px;height:60px}.logo-placeholder{padding-bottom:20px}.main-content{width:480px}@media(max-width:480px){.main-content{width:100vw}}.card-donation{min-height:130px;max-height:145px;margin:0}.card-img-donation{width:100%;min-height:130px;height:100%;max-height:145px;object-fit:contain;border-radius:calc(.25rem - 1px) 0 0 calc(.25rem - 1px)}.card-img-donation.broken{object-fit:contain}.card-img-donation-fund{width:100%;min-height:130px;height:100%;max-height:145px;object-fit:cover;border-radius:calc(.25rem - 1px) 0 0 calc(.25rem - 1px)}.card-img-donation-fund.broken{object-fit:cover}@media(max-width:374px){.card-donation{width:100%;max-height:max-content;display:flex;flex-direction:column}.card-donation>div{width:100%;max-width:100%}.card-img-donation{max-height:180px;border-radius:calc(.25rem - 1px) calc(.25rem - 1px) 0 0}}@media(max-width:500px){.card-img-donation-fund{max-height:180px;border-radius:calc(.25rem - 1px) calc(.25rem - 1px) 0 0}.fundraising-program-title{font-size:1.5rem;margin:1rem auto}}.card-img-swiper-item{width:225px;height:90px;object-fit:cover;border-radius:10px}@media(min-width:768px){.card-img-swiper-item{width:380px;height:135px}}@media(min-width:376px)and (max-width:767px){.card-img-swiper-item{width:320px;height:125px}}@media(min-width:321px)and (max-width:375px){.card-img-swiper-item{width:280px;height:110px}}.w-image-card{width:100%}@media(min-width:768px){.w-image-card{width:49%}}.progress{height:.5rem}.button-verified{padding:0}.bottom-nav{width:inherit!important;right:auto!important}.txt-xs{font-size:12px}.swiper-slide{flex-shrink:unset!important}.loading-center-screen{display:flex;justify-content:center;align-items:center;height:100vh}.loading-center{width:100%;display:flex;justify-content:center}.card-donation-info{text-align:center;width:100%;padding:1.5rem}.card-donation-info h5{font-size:1.2rem}.bg-image{position:fixed;top:0;left:0;z-index:-1}.bg-grey-1,.bg-image{width:100%;height:100%}.bg-grey-1{background-color:#f5f5f5}.main-content-fundraising{width:480px;margin:0 auto}@media(max-width:480px){.main-content-fundraising{width:100vw}}.alert{border:none;border-radius:0;padding:19px 25px;margin:0;color:#6c757d;background-color:#f8f9fa}